Default Cannot add services

Hello all,

My version of Connectra:
NGX R62 HFA_01, Hotfix 601 - Build 006

My problem:
When connected to Connectra (https://192.168.0.1:4433) and getting to "Settings/Services" tab, I cannot add any new service.

Error message:
Error
Server error (error code = GENERAL_ERROR)

A ticket was logged at CP.

Would you happen to know a workaround for this problem? Can I update a file manually so that new ports are added into my configuration?

Thanks for your help and comments.

Hello Ray,

It was IE6.

Anyway, checkpoint support didn't find out any quick fix for the problem, so we finally chosed to upgrade our SmartCenter to NGX R65 and to upgrade the Connectra to NGX R62CM. Now services are directly managed from the SmartCenter, case closed.

Hello,

I post the response from Check Point :

Spoke with the customer and explained him that we tried a couple of solution and the way to solve the issue it to take the upgrade_export, reinstall the machine and import configuration back.
